Registered Member
|
Hello,
I’m moving from Skrooge 2.7.0 to 2.18.0 to be able to use new features (especially payees categories). I get the following error when opening the file:
I’m sorry it’s partly in french. Is there anyway to fix this or to get more details on the error? |
Moderator
|
Bonsoir,
Je suis le développeur de Skrooge et cette erreur est clairement pas normale. Je ne comprends pas pourquoi cela arrive. Je soupçonne des opérations non associées à un compte. Pour pouvoir analyser en détail, il me faudrait un fichier pour reproduire le problème. Pourriez vous faire ceci ? 1- Avec Skrooge 2.7.0, créer un fichier anonyme (Voir Outils / Rendre anonyme) 2- Avec Skrooge 2.18.0, ouvrir le fichier anonyme => vous devriez avoir le même problème 3- M'envoyer le fichier anonyme par mail (vous trouverez mon adresse dans le "A propos ..." de skrooge) Par avance merci pour votre aide. Cordialement. |
Registered Member
|
Ok, je tenterais ça demain.
Je peux déjà vous dire deux choses:
|
Moderator
|
Super.
Moi aussi, je suis au crédit coop. En effet, ils ont changé les numéros de comptes mais il suffit que vous changiez les numéros de comptes dans Skrooge pour que les nouveaux imports se fassent dans les comptes initiaux. Vous pouvez aussi essayer un "Drag & Drop" d'un compte sur un autre pour déplacer toutes les opérations. |
Moderator
|
Bonjour,
Avez vous généré le fichier anonymisé? Cordialement. |
Registered Member
|
Ça y est j’ai envoyé le fichier anonymisé par courriel.
Je confirme qu’il cause une erreur à l’ouverture aussi. |
Moderator
|
Bonjour,
Merci pour le fichier. J'arrive à l'ouvrir sans problème. Dans les traces, on voit bien les différentes migrations et il n'y a pas d'erreur au passage sur le version 10.2.
Pourriez vous générer des traces chez vous? Pour cela faire ceci depuis une console:
Vous devriez avoir l'erreur, puis m'envoyer le fichier par mail. |
Moderator
|
Hi,
Just for information, the issue seems to be due to sqlcipher. The workaround is to do the migration with an older version of sqlcipher. For example: on ubuntu. See this post: viewtopic.php?f=210&t=159771&p=414062#p414062 I will try to reproduce this issue by using the last version sqlcipher. |
Moderator
|
Hi,
As you can see here https://sqlite.org/lang_altertable.html the issue is due to a change in sqlite 3.25.0. I know how to fix it. I will try to do it soon. |
Moderator
|
Hi,
For your information: 1- I did a correction: https://cgit.kde.org/skrooge.git/commit ... 8712cf6f61 2-I opened a bug on Arch to package ASAP this correction: https://bugs.archlinux.org/task/61940 |
Registered Member
|
Sorry for the delay, I can confirm the problem is solved
Thank you! |
Registered users: Bing [Bot], claydoh, Evergrowing, Google [Bot], rblackwell